Simone De Beauvoir Quotes

I Was Struck By The Absence, Even Among Very Young Boys And Girls, Of Any Interior Motivation; They Were Incapable Of Thinking, Of Inventing, Of Imagining, Of Choosing, Of Deciding For Themselves; This Incapacity Was Expressed By Their Conformism; In Every Domain Of Life They Employed Only The Abstract Measure Of Money, Because They Were Unable To Trust To Their Own Judgment.
